I'd make minimum payments and put any extra money you have laying around into a Roth IRA and invest it

You can get a minor tax break on interest paid on student loans and you'll get a nice tax benefit of putting the money in the IRA

The interest rate on those loans isn't high enough to justify being in a huge rush to pay them off IMO since you could probably beat those rates with a fairly low risk investment strategy.

If they were really high credit card rates like 18% or something I'd be telling you something different.
